Even the name of "Fat Tuesday" implies that there should be at least a little indulgence in the day. In keeping with the tradition of making pancakes to celebrate the last day before lent, I made a batch of pancakes, using up some buttermilk, butter and eggs. As if that weren't enough for a delicious breakfast of classic comfort food, I added chocolate chips to really get into the decadent spirit of Mardi Gras. The pancakes themselves are light and fluffy, and the chocolate chips melt deliciously into your mouth as you eat. These don't really need syrup, but to really get into the theme of "Fat Tuesday", top yours with whipped cream. IF you have kids, use the whipped cream to make a smiley face, just like the IHOP Funny Face Pancakes.
